An assistant diving at the aquarium and ocean life reserve, Sea Life Park, on Waimanalo Beach, near Makapuu Point, on Oahu, Hawaii. It was founded by Taylor "Tap" Pryor, a Hawaiian State Senator, and his wife, Karen. This assistant is swimming in a pool which accurately reproduces a Hawaiian coral reef.
